What JIS Z 2248 Covers
It bends a metal specimen around a former to a specified angle and assesses the tension surface for cracking, the JIS equivalent of the international bend test.
How the Test Is Run
The specimen is bent in a fixture around a former of defined diameter, then examined for cracks on the outer surface to confirm the required bendability.
Why It Matters
Bend testing is a quick ductility acceptance check for metal products; a rigid fixture and correct former size are essential.

Related Standards
ISO 7438 is the international bend method and JIS Z 2204 defines the bend specimen geometry.
